Can a private member of a class be accessible?
Private. The most restrictive access level is private. A private member is accessible only to the class in which it is defined. Use this access to declare members that should only be used by the class.Can a private member of a class be accessed from its derived class?
Private members of the base class cannot be used by the derived class unless friend declarations within the base class explicitly grant access to them.Can private class members Cannot be accessed or viewed from outside the class?
In C++, there are three access specifiers: public - members are accessible from outside the class. private - members cannot be accessed (or viewed) from outside the class. protected - members cannot be accessed from outside the class, however, they can be accessed in inherited classes.How to access private class members in Java?
Ways that you can access private members of a class :
- Use a public getter method: One option is to create a public method in the class that returns the value of the private field. ...
- Use a public setter method: You can also create a public method in the class that sets the value of the private field.
How do you access private members of a class in Python?
The members of a class that are declared private are accessible within the class only, private access modifier is the most secure access modifier. Data members of a class are declared private by adding a double underscore '__' symbol before the data member of that class.Accessing Private member functions in C++ | C ++ Tutorial | Mr. Kishore
How do I access private members of a class in main class?
We have used the getter and setter method to access the private variables. Here, the setter methods setAge() and setName() initializes the private variables. the getter methods getAge() and getName() returns the value of private variables.Can private members of a Python class Cannot be accessed?
Private members of a class cannot be accessed. Explanation: Private members of a class are accessible if written as follows: obj. _Classname__privatemember. Such renaming of identifiers is called as name mangling.Can we access private members in Java?
A private member is accessible only to the class in which it is defined. Use this access to declare members that should only be used by the class.How do you access private variables in a class?
If you need to access a private variable from outside the class, you can use public "getter" and "setter" methods. A getter method allows you to retrieve the value of the private variable, while a setter method allows you to modify its value. This encapsulation helps maintain the integrity of the class and its data.Can you access private methods from outside a class Python?
Private methods are inaccessible: Although private methods are not directly accessible from outside the class, they can still be called internally using the mangled name.Which private members of a class Cannot be accessed?
Explanation: The private member functions can never be accessed in the derived classes. The access specifiers is of maximum security that allows only the members of self class to access the private member functions. 4.Which member is not accessible outside the class?
Private: The access level of a private modifier is only within the class. It cannot be accessed from outside the class. Default: The access level of a default modifier is only within the package.Why private class is not allowed?
Private classes are allowed, but only as inner or nested classes. If you have a private inner or nested class, then access is restricted to the scope of that outer class. If you have a private class on its own as a top-level class, then you can't get access to it from anywhere.Can a private member of a class Cannot be accessed by the methods of the same class?
private: the member (variable or method) can only be accessed from within a (any) method inside the same class.Which can be used to access a private member of a class?
Getter and setter functions are used to access and modify the private members of a class.Can a class have both private and public members?
Each can hold data of different types in a single data structure. When you define a class, you can make members Public (so members can be referred to by statements outside the class definition) or Private (so members can be referred to only by properties and methods defined in that class).Does private members get inherited in Java?
Inheritance is a powerful feature of object-oriented programming that allows classes to inherit properties and behaviors from other classes. Private variables, however, cannot be directly inherited in Java. Child classes can access private variables of the parent class only through public or protected methods.Can private methods be inherited?
Only protected and public methods/variables can be inherited and/or overridden. Private means you can Only access it in that class an no where else. Subclasses can only invoke or override protected or public methods (or methods without access modifiers, if the superclass is in the same package) from their superclasses.How to access private members of class using constructor?
Private constructors in Java are accessed only from within the class. You cannot access a private constructor from any other class. If the object is yet not initialised, then you can write a public function to call the private instructor.How to access private and protected members in Java?
The private modifier specifies that the member can only be accessed in its own class. The protected modifier specifies that the member can only be accessed within its own package (as with package-private) and, in addition, by a subclass of its class in another package.How to access private members of a class in another package in Java?
You can access the private methods of a class using java reflection package.
- Step1 − Instantiate the Method class of the java. lang. ...
- Step2 − Set the method accessible by passing value true to the setAccessible() method.
- Step3 − Finally, invoke the method using the invoke() method.
Can private members be accessed using friend functions?
A friend function in C++ is defined as a function that can access private, protected, and public members of a class. The friend function is declared using the friend keyword inside the body of the class.What are private and protected members of a class can be accessed by?
private: The type or member can be accessed only by code in the same class or struct . protected: The type or member can be accessed only by code in the same class , or in a class that is derived from that class .Are all class members public in Python?
Then I came to learn that the access modifier in Python is denoted by using a naming convention. Python does not strictly offer any access modifier, hence, all variables and methods are public by default. Therefore, any class member can be read outside of the class.Are class members private by default?
Default access of members in a class is private. Default access of members in a structure or union is public. Default access of a base class is private for classes and public for structures.
← Previous question
What hospital is Tufts affiliated with?
What hospital is Tufts affiliated with?
Next question →
Do school uniforms stifle expression?
Do school uniforms stifle expression?